
Saint Lô, France – October 22, 2022 – Mathieu Billot (FRA) and Darling de L’Angevine claimed top honors in the €25,500 Crédit Agricole Normandie CSI 4* last Saturday during the Jumping International St. Lô CSI 4* at the Pôle Hippique de Saint-Lô.
Riding the 2013 bay Selle Français mare (Air Jordan x Clinton), Billot bested 10 other contestants in the tiebreaker, clearing all the 1.45m obstacles before crossing the finish line in 36.45 seconds.
Alexa Ferrer (FRA) and Arka de La Hart Z (Arko III x Kashmir van Schuttershof) were just over a hal-second slower, registering no penalties in 36.96 seconds to secure silver honors in the jump-off.
An all-French podium was denied by Gudrun Patteet (BEL), who guided Sea Coast Enjoy Z (Emerald van’t Ruytershof x Parco) towards the third spot on the podium, backed by a clean scorecard and final time of 37.20 seconds.
